stranger danger is only part of what a child should know

Teaching only stranger danger to your kids is irresponsible.  More children are abused by somebody they know than by a stranger.  A better policy would be to discuss with your child inappropriate touching, and the right to say NO.  Let your child know that if somebody tries to touch their private parts that you want him/her to tell you.  The child is never to blame when abuse happens.  You can't be with your child every waking moment, but you can give them the tools to protect themselves.  I was sexually abused by a relative...it never occurred to me that I had the power to say NO and to tell on him.  Nobody ever taught me that...I didn't know that it was wrong...I just felt icky...I thought I would get in trouble if I told my parents...as if I was somehow responsible for allowing it to happen.  Please educate your children about inappropriate touching as well as stranger danger.  I've been through years of counseling to try to repair the damage that was done.
